Wix.com Ltd. (NASDAQ: WIX) is a leading cloud-based web development platform that enables users to create and manage professional websites without requiring technical expertise. Established in 2006, the company has gained popularity for its user-friendly interface, extensive customization options, and an array of integrated tools designed to enhance online presence. Wix caters to a diverse clientele, including small businesses, freelancers, and e-commerce ventures, with over 200 million users in more than 190 countries as of 2023.
One of Wix’s main selling points is its drag-and-drop website builder, which allows users to design websites visually, along with various templates tailored for different industries. With features like Wix Code, users can create more complex applications directly within the platform. The company also offers services such as domain registration, hosting, and marketing tools, allowing users to manage their online presence comprehensively.
Financially, Wix has experienced significant growth, although it faced challenges during the post-pandemic recovery period as user acquisition slowed. In recent quarters, Wix has been focusing on cost management and improving profitability, which has contributed to a more stable financial outlook. Analysts have been keeping a close watch on its strategic initiatives to expand into the e-commerce space, particularly as online shopping continues to thrive.
Wix’s stock performance has been characterized by volatility, reflective of broader market trends and investor sentiment towards tech stocks. As of October 2023, the company’s performance in the stock market is scrutinized closely, especially regarding its path to profitability and the sustainability of its revenue streams amid fierce competition from other website builders and content management systems.
Overall, Wix.com Ltd. remains a significant player in the digital landscape, continually adapting its offerings to accommodate the changing needs of businesses looking to establish their online footprint.

Wix.com Ltd is a cloud-based development platform provider for millions of registered users worldwide. The company is engaged in web development and management that provides an easy-to-use powerful cloud-based platform of products through a freemium model. Its core products consist of three web editors: the Wix Editor, intended for users with basic technological skills, Wix ADI, intended for novice users and Corvid, intended for more tech-savvy users. The company's web development technology is built based on HTML5 and offers HTML5 compatible capabilities, web design and layout tools, domain hosting, and other marketing and workflow management applications and services. The geographic segments include North America, Europe, Latin America, Asia and others.
